What is a US Health Wellbeing Manager?

A US Health Wellbeing Manager is a professional responsible for designing, implementing, and managing programs that promote health, wellness, and a positive work environment within organizations. They focus on employee wellbeing through initiatives such as health screenings, fitness programs, mental health resources, and education on healthy lifestyle choices. Their goal is to improve overall employee health, increase productivity, and reduce healthcare costs for the company. They often collaborate with HR, healthcare providers, and external vendors to deliver effective wellbeing solutions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a US Health Wellbeing Manager?

To thrive as a US Health Wellbeing Manager, you typically need a background in health promotion, public health, or a related field, along with experience in program management and employee wellness initiatives. Familiarity with data analytics tools, health risk assessment platforms, and sometimes certifications like Certified Wellness Practitioner (CWP) or Certified Health Education Specialist (CHES) are valuable. Strong interpersonal skills, leadership, and the ability to motivate and engage diverse groups of employees are essential soft skills. These competencies ensure the successful design, implementation, and evaluation of wellbeing programs that improve employee health outcomes and organizational productivity.

How does a US Health Wellbeing Manager typically collaborate with other departments to implement wellness initiatives?

A US Health Wellbeing Manager regularly works with HR, benefits teams, and sometimes external wellness vendors to design and implement programs that support employee health. Collaboration often involves coordinating health screenings, wellness challenges, and educational workshops, while ensuring compliance with company policies and regulations. The role also requires gathering feedback from employees and managers across departments to tailor initiatives to the organization's unique needs. Effective communication and project management skills are crucial for aligning wellness strategies with broader organizational goals.

Job description

Overview of Position
As part of the Total Rewards & Wellbeing team, this role leads the strategy, governance, and continuous improvement of Assurant's global benefits programs, with primary accountability for global health and welfare benefits, leave and disability programs, and wellbeing initiatives. The role partners across regions to strengthen program consistency, improve efficiency, and enhance the employee experience, and ensure benefits programs remain competitive, compliant, and aligned with Assurant's Total Rewards strategy.
Global Benefits Strategy, Harmonization & Governance - 45%
  • Lead the evolution of Assurant's global benefits strategy to support business priorities, workforce needs, and Total Rewards objectives.
  • Build and maintain a global benefits inventory to identify gaps, reduce inconsistencies, strengthen governance, and prioritize harmonization opportunities.
  • Partner with regional HR teams, external consultants, and vendors to evaluate market competitiveness, program effectiveness, and governance practices.
  • Support global benefits reviews, benchmarking studies, M&A due diligence, integration planning, and other strategic initiatives.
  • Develop recommendations, insights, and executive-ready materials that enable informed leadership decisions.

Leave & Disability Program Management - 25%
  • Lead the strategy, governance, and ongoing administration of U.S. and global leave and disability programs to deliver consistent, compliant and employee-centered solutions.
  • Partner with WTW, carriers, and internal stakeholders to improve program design, processes, service delivery, and employee experience.
  • Monitor program performance, utilization trends, compliance requirements, operational effectiveness, and emerging trends to inform improvements and manage risk.
  • Identify opportunities to improve integration across leave, disability, accommodations, wellbeing, and benefits programs for a more seamless employee experience.
  • Drive program enhancements, vendor implementations, and future-state process improvements that increase efficiency and scalability.

Vendor Governance, Operations & Compliance - 20%
  • Manage key vendor relationships across health, wellbeing, leave, and disability programs, including business reviews, performance guarantees, renewals, and contract support.
  • Partner with Procurement, Legal, Risk Management, Finance, and HR stakeholders to strengthen vendor governance, controls, and regulatory oversight.
  • Oversee health and welfare compliance activities, audits, reporting obligations, plan documentation, and governance requirements.
  • Drive operational excellence through process documentation, reporting, issue resolution, and continuous improvement routines.

Wellbeing, Employee Experience & Insights - 10%
  • Support the development and execution of global wellbeing strategies focused on physical, emotional, financial, and social wellbeing across the workforce.
  • Leverage employee feedback, utilization data, and market insights to identify opportunities to improve engagement and program effectiveness.
  • Partner with Communications, HR teams, and employee networks to increase awareness and appreciation of benefits and wellbeing programs.
  • Serve as a subject matter resource for employee experience and benefits navigation initiatives.

Travel is less than 5%
What are the requirements needed for this position?
  •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or related field or equivalent experience.
  • Minimum of 8 years of progressively responsible benefits experience, including significant experience in global benefits strategy, governance, harmonization, and leave/disability program management.

Other Experience:
  • Demonstrated vendor management experience, including RFP support, renewals, contracting, business reviews, SLA/performance guarantee monitoring, and issue resolution.
  • Experience using benefits data, vendor reporting, and employee insights to develop recommendations and improve program performance.
  • Strong understanding of ERISA, HIPAA, COBRA, ACA, CAA transparency requirements, and other health and welfare compliance considerations.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to translate complex benefits topics into leadership-ready materials.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ities, work in a matrixed environment, and partner effectively across HR, Finance, Legal, Procurement, Communications, and external vendors.

What other skills/experience would be helpful to have?
  • Experience leading global benefits inventories, country-by-country assessments, and benefits harmonization initiatives.
  • Experience overseeing leave administration platforms and disability programs in partnership with external consultants and vendors.
  • Experience supporting multinational organizations with benefits governance and strategy development.
